Overview of noun cole
The noun cole has 2 senses (no senses from tagged texts)
1. kale, kail, cole, borecole, colewort, Brassica oleracea acephala -- (a hardy cabbage with coarse curly leaves that do not form a head)
2. kale, kail, cole -- (coarse curly-leafed cabbage)
